News ==> Search Engine Land reminds us that today from 10 am to 11: 30 am Pacific time, Google is having a Searchology Event: An “Insider’s Perspective On Search”.

So What? ==> As the SEL article asserts, the first event they had of this nature in 2007, they announced Universal Search, which had a big impact on SEO, which then had an impact on your business. Google skipped the big deal last year.
